New BYD Battery with More Range Will Be Used in Buses
The new double-decker bus from BYD, named B11, was launched on May 21 at the London Bus Museum, and is set to challenge the famous New Routemaster in London.
Apart from the previously mentioned data, the battery set 11 times larger than that of the Dolphin Mini will have a consumption rate of 1.4 km per kWh and a usable capacity of 457 kWh. Additionally, the battery is embedded in the chassis, which is said to reduce its weight by 8%, increase its range, and provide more space for passengers.

In addition to the new high-range battery, there are two wheel electric motors, each with 203 hp of power. It is possible to connect two chargers to the bus simultaneously, aiming to increase the charging speed, which is done from 0 to 100% in two hours.
It is worth mentioning that the average range of a bus in the English capital is 160 km to 320 km, making the 640 km range with the new BYD battery more than sufficient for being the new bus in the city.
Check Out All the Details of the New BYD Bus
The replacement of buses is expected because the Go-Ahead group, which operates as Transport for London, is close to placing an order for 100 new buses, and these are likely to be BYD’s, largely due to their price.
According to The Sunday Times, the cost of such a vehicle is 400,000 euros, about 100,000 euros cheaper than most of its competitors sold there. Although its production takes place in China, BYD stated that 34% of the vehicle’s components, which features the new high-range battery 11 times larger than that of the Dolphin Mini, are of European origin.
It is worth mentioning that BYD has been selling its buses in the UK to producer Alexander Dennis for 11 years and has sold 1,500 units before the partnership ended. Its dimensions are 10.9 m in length, 5.44 m in wheelbase, 2.55 m in width, and 4.3 m in height. The maximum capacity is 90 passengers, depending on the configuration used. Smaller one-story versions of the vehicle for regions in the interior of the country are already being developed.
BYD Will Launch 2nd Generation of Its High-Range Battery
In addition to this new high-range battery that is 11 times larger than that of the Dolphin Mini, which equips the bus, BYD announces the arrival of the second generation of the Blade battery, with a planned launch for August of this year.
The new technology promises to be a significant step forward with advancements in range, performance, and cost. The revelation was recently made by BYD’s CEO, Wang Chuanfu, who spoke about the new development for the first time during a financial results communication meeting regarding BYD currently developing a second-generation Blade battery system.
